The Bently Nevada 990-05-70-01-00 vibration transmitter is an advanced condition monitoring device designed to provide precise and real-time vibration data for rotating machinery. It belongs to the Bently Nevada 990 series, which is known for its high accuracy and reliability in monitoring equipment health. This transmitter is an ideal solution for industries where the condition / machinery is critical for operational performance, including power generation, oil and gas, manufacturing, and petrochemicals.
This model helps detect early signs / mechanical failures, such as imbalances, misalignments, or bearing wear, before they lead to expensive repairs or unplanned downtime. The 990-05-70-01-00 is engineered to operate effectively in harsh environments and provides continuous monitoring, which is essential for predictive maintenance programs. Its compact design, combined with its powerful performance, ensures it can be easily integrated into existing monitoring systems without causing significant disruptions.
Overall, the 990-05-70-01-00 /fers valuable insights into machinery performance, enabling operators to make informed decisions about when and where to perform maintenance, thus enhancing overall productivity and reducing operational costs.
製品仕様
| Parameter | Specification |
|---|---|
| Dimensions | 100.1 x 73.9 x 53.3 mm |
| 重量 | 0.43 kg |
| Power Supply | 18 to 36 VDC |
| Output Signal | 4-20 mA, 2-wire |
| Measurement Range | 0-1000 m/s² (maximum vibration acceleration) |
| Frequency Range | 1 Hz to 10 kHz |
| Operating Temperature | -40°C to +85°C |
| Storage Temperature | -40°C to +85°C |
| Enclosure Rating | IP65 (dust-tight and water-resistant) |
| Mounting | Standard 4-20 mA loop, threaded mounting holes |
| Vibration Sensitivity | High precision, ±1% accuracy over full measurement range |
| Certifications | CE, UL, RoHS |
| Operating Humidity | 0-95% non-condensing |
